Studies in the Linguistic Geography of Essex

Description

M.A. thesis comprising three volumes. Volume One contains six chapters, the first being a description of the Essex sounds recorded in 1958, 1959 and 1961. Chapters Two to Six treat the development of Middle English short vowels, long vowels, diphthongs, vowels of unstressed syllables, and consonants, respectively. Volume Two comprises tables of Essex sounds recorded between 1958 and 1961, ordered according to their Middle English sources, and orthographic transcripts of the gramophone disc recordings of speakers which accompany the thesis. Volume Three contains maps illustrating the regional distribution of selected phonological features discussed in Volume One and displayed in the tables of Volume Two.
